Ingredients

To prepare this comforting dish, you’ll need the following ingredients:
– 1 pound ground beef
– 1 cup rice (white or brown)
– 2 cups beef broth or water
– 1 onion, chopped
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 can diced tomatoes (optional)
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Olive oil

Step-by-Step Instructions for Ground Beef and Rice

Preparing Ground Beef and Rice is straightforward and rewarding. Follow these simple steps to create a delicious meal:
1.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at.
2.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, sautéing until softened for about 3-5 minutes.
3. Add the ground beef, breaking it apart, and cook until browned, approximately 5-7 minutes.
4. Stir in the rice and allow it to cook for 1-2 minutes until slightly toasted.
5. Pour in the beef broth (or water) and the diced tomatoes, if using.
6.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at to low, cover, and let it simmer for about 20 minutes, or until the rice is fully cooked and the liquid is absorbed.
7.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
8. Serve warm and enjoy this hearty meal.

Pro Tips and Variations:

To enhance your Ground Beef and Rice or tweak it based on your preferences, consider these pro tips and variations:
– Spice it up: Add chili powder or cayenne for a kick.
– Vegetable options: Mix in bell peppers, peas, or corn for added nutrition and flavor.
– Alternative proteins: Substitute ground turkey or chicken for a leaner dish.
– Herb infusion: Add fresh or dried herbs like parsley or thyme to elevate flavors.
– Slow cooker version: Combine all ingredients in a slow cooker and cook on low for about 4 hours for a hands-off meal.

How to Store Ground Beef and Rice

Storing leftovers of Ground Beef and Rice is easy. Simply transfer them to an airtight container and place them in the refrigerator. Properly stored, they will last for 3-4 days. For longer storage, consider freezing portions in freezer-safe containers for up to 3 months. When ready to enjoy, reheat in the microwave or on the stove over low heat, adding a splash of water or broth to maintain moisture and prevent drying.

FAQs about Ground Beef and Rice

1. Can I use brown rice instead of white rice?
Yes, you can substitute brown rice, but you may need to increase the cooking time and liquid.

  1. Is it possible to make this dish gluten-free?
    Absolutely. Just ensure that the broth you use is gluten-free.

  2. Can I prepare this dish in advance?
    Yes, you can cook it ahead of time and reheat when you’re ready to serve.

  3. What can I serve on the side?
    A green salad, roasted vegetables, or pita bread pair wonderfully with Ground Beef and Rice.
